Transaction 8e580a33ab114c14af8cf0b390a608bfb78a700adb6d5c5dbb09c0183ff79487
1 Input
1 Output
-
8e580a33ab114c14af8cf0b390a608bfb78a700adb6d5c5dbb09c0183ff79487:0
- value
- 13254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 944e686ea9bf27e7ea21ad95baa6f5f6928c27bd OP_EQUAL
- address
- 3FDBrp9fQxdhHkUBxh2xgVBJsAwwX8agfX